Shared Cognitive Processes



When we dive into the common cognitive processes between music and language, you'll locate there's more overlap than you may expect. Both music and language rely upon similar brain functions, involving locations that process acoustic details, rhythm, and patterns. This shared foundation implies that abilities in one domain can enhance capabilities in the various other.

For instance, when you pay attention to music, your brain analyzes pitch, tone, and tempo. In a similar way, when you hear talked language, it deciphers phonetics, intonation, and rhythm. This parallel handling promotes a heightened sensitivity to seem, which can enhance your total acoustic discrimination skills.

In addition, involving with music can help you establish a stronger sense of rhythm, which is important for understanding the structure of language. You might discover that when you sing along to a song, your mind turns on the very same locations that it would certainly when creating or interpreting sentences.
